I - Special event station IY1SP is being activated (on the HF bands CW,
SSB and RTTY, plus 2 and 6 metres) by ARI La Spezia through 31
January to celebrate the 100th anniversary of Guglielmo Marconi's
first wireless transmission between the United States and Europe,
as well as the experiments carried out by Marconi and the Italian
Navy at La Spezia in 1903. A special QSL will be sent automatically
via bureau. [TNX IW1PDP]
J3 - Bill, VE3EBN will be active again as J37LR from Grenada from 31
January through 2 April. He will operate on 10-80 metres CW and
SSB. QSL via VE3EBN, [TNX NG3K]
J7 - Bob Reiser. AA1M and Mike Rioux, W1USN will be active as J75PL and
J75RN respectively from Dominica (NA-101) on 21-28 January.
Operations will be on the HF bands with activity in CW, SSB and
PSK31. QSL via home calls (direct or bureau). [TNX AA1M]
JA - JI5USJ and JI5RPT plan to operate (on 160-10 metres SSB, CW, RTTY
and PSK31) as homecall/6 from the Daito Islands (AS-047) for about
one week in early March. Details are expected in due course. [TNX
JI6KVR]
JA - Look for JQ1SUO/1, JF1CCH/1 and JA2HMD/1 to be active (on 10, 15,
20, 30 and 40 metres CW and SSB) from Hachijo Island (AS-043) on
8-9 March. [TNX JI6KVR]
JW - SM0BSO, SM0LQB and SM1TDE will be active from Svalbard from 24
February to 1 March. They will operate from the clubstation JW5E
located in Longyearbyen, Spitsbergen (EU-026). Look for JW/SM0BSO,
JW/SM0LQB and JW/SM1TDE to be active on 160-2 metres CW, SSB, RTTY
and other digital modes. One station will be devoted to 6m and
another one to the satellites (AO-7, AO-10, UO-14, FO-20, FO-29).
QSL via home calls, bureau or direct. Further information can be
found at http://w1.865.telia.com/~u86523219/JW03.htm [TNX SM1TDE]
KG4 - Pick, WA5PAE (KG4IZ) and Jay, K4ZLE (KG4MO) will return to
Guantanamo Bay from 28 January until 4 Feburary. They will operate
all bands from 160 to 10 metres using mostly CW, PSK-31 and RTTY.
QSL via home calls either direct or through the bureau. [TNX NG3K]
LU - Look for LU6EPR/E, LW4DRH/E, LU8EBJ/E, LW3DKC/E and other members
from the Bahia Blanca DX Group (http://www.geocities.com/bbdxgroup)
to be active from Recalada Lighthouse (ARG-009) during the weekends
of January and February starting on 17 January. QSL via LU7DSY
(Carlos Almiron, P.O. Box 709, 8000 Bahia Blanca, Argentina). [TNX
LU6EPR]
LZ_ssh - Danny, LZ2UU is currently active from LZ0A at St. Kliment Ohridski
base (WABA LZ-02) on Livingston Island, South Shetlands (AN-010).
QSL via LZ1KDP.
OH0 - Look for OH5DX (ex OH1EH) to participate in the CQ 160 Meter
Contest (CW) as OH0Z (http://www.qsl.net/oh0z) from the Aland
Islands. QSL via OH5DX (Ari Korhonen, Kreetalank. 9A1, FIN 29200
Harjavalta, Finland). [TNX OH5DX]
OZ - Alan, G0RCI and other operators from the Grantham Amateur Radio
will be active (on all bands CW, SSB and maybe SSTV and other
modes) as OZ/G0GRC from either Fur, Livoe or Vendsyssel-Thy (all
counts for EU-171) on 2-6 June. All QSOs will be acknowledged
within 28 days of the operators' return, QSL cards are not
required. [TNX G0RCI]
PJ - W8UVZ, K8GG and KD9SV will be active (mainly on the low and WARC
bands) as PJ2/homecall from Curacao (SA-006) on 20-29 January. QSL
via home call. They will participate in the CQ 160 Meter CW
Contest, requested call is PJ2X (QSL via W8UVZ). [TNX OPDX
Bulletin]
PJ - Look for Ron, PJ7/ND5S and Sue, PJ7/KF5LG to be operating from St.
Maarten (NA-105) from 9 through 22 February. Ron will participate
in the ARRL CW DX Contest. Outside the contest activity will be 160
through 10 metres CW, RTTY and SSB in that order. QSL via ND5S
(direct or bureau). Details of past trips can be found at
http://www.qsl.net/nd5s [TNX ND5S]
PJ - Look for Klaus, DJ4SO to be active on 40-6 metres (plus 160 and 80
if it is possible to install the antenna at the hotel) CW, SSB and
RTTY as PJ6/DJ4SO from Saba (NA-145) from 18 February to 12 March.
QSL via home call either direct or through the bureau (email
requests for bureau cards are welcome at dj4so@darc.de). [TNX
DJ5AV]
PY0_fn - Bill, W5SJ will participate in the CQ WW 160 Meter CW Contest as
PR0F from Fernando de Noronha (SA-003). Before and after the
contest he might use PY0F/W5SJ and will concentrate on 30, 17 and
12 metres CW (with some SSB upon request). QSL via W5SJ. [TNX The
Daily DX]
S2 - John, KX7YT will be active as S21YV from Dhaka, Bangladesh from 27
January to 2 March. He plans to operate on 10, 15 and 20 metres
SSB, PSK31 and CW. Usual operating times are 12 UTC to 16 UTC
daily. John will be active during the ARRL CW and Phone DX
Contests, work schedule permitting. QSL via home call. [TNX KX7YT]
SP - Operators from club station SP4KSY will be active as 3Z0OL on 17-18
January. They will operate from the cloister of the ancient castle
of Olsztyn, where Nicolaus Copernicus carried out his reasearches
on the equinox. QSL via SQ4NR either direct (Grzegorz Gawel, ul.
Herdera 16/14, 10-691 Olsztyn, Poland) or through the bureau. [TNX
SQ4NR]
UR_ant - Roman, UT7UA is expected to be at Vernadsky base (WABA UR-01) on
Galindez Island (AN-006) for the upcoming austral winter season. He
will arrive in late January or early February and will operate
again as VP8CTR. QSL via DL5EBE. [TNX DL5EBE]
V2 - Wicky, W4LW and Fred, K4FMD will operate V2/K4UP from Antigua
(NA-100) on 2-8 February. The operation will be casual style on 10,
12, 15, 17, and 20 metres SSB only. QSL via K4UP direct or bureau.
[TNX N2BT]
V4 - AC8W, K8DD and one or two other operators will be active from St.
Kitts (NA-104) on 12-19 February, ARRL DX CW Contest included.
Before and after the contest they will operate PSK31, RTTY and on
the WARC bands. QSL via home calls (personal calls have been
applied for in addition to a contest call, details are expected in
due course). [TNX K8DD]
V5 - Hubertus, DJ1HN is active as V51/DJ1HN from Namibia through 28
January. He operates on 10, 15 and 20 metres SSB. QSL via DJ1HN.
[TNX DX Newsletter]
